Superior Protection: The Advantages of Nitrile Gloves
Nitrile gloves provide a degree of protection that exceeds latex and vinyl. Their chemical-resistant properties guarantee them ideal for a wide range of applications, from medical procedures to industrial tasks.
Furthermore, nitrile gloves are highly durable and puncture-resistant. They in addition provide a comfortable fit thanks to their pliable nature.
This combination of characteristics produces nitrile gloves the leading choice for professionals who demand dependable hand protection.

Beyond Medical Use: Industrial Applications of Nitrile Gloves
Nitrile gloves have become more than just a standard item in the medical field. Their remarkable resistance to chemicals and puncture makes them suitable for a wide variety of industrial applications.
From processing to servicing, nitrile gloves provide essential protection against harmful substances and chemicals. Personnel in industries such as electronics rely on these gloves for safety.
Furthermore, the strength of nitrile gloves allows them to withendure demanding environments. They deliver a high level of precision, enabling workers to execute delicate tasks with accuracy.

Disposing of Nitrile Gloves Responsibly
Nitrile gloves make an essential barrier against unwanted substances in various occupations. However, it's important to get rid of them responsibly to nitrile gloves protect our ecosystem. Make sure to take off your gloves upon completion and avoid soiling them with unsafe materials.
- Deposit used gloves in a designated wastebasket that is clearly identified for infection control waste.
- If you are unable to find a proper container, double bag the gloves before throwing away them in the municipal waste stream.
- Often disinfect any surfaces that were touched by nitrile gloves.
